Kevin, You shouldn't be using any GPOs if you're using ConfigMgr to deploy software updates. There's a good chance that you have a GPO settings that's overriding the ConfigMgr behavior of suppressing reboots. That could be why you're seeing what you're seeing. Cheers, Trevor Sullivan
